Conference Paper: Interest-based learning: EdTech-assisted Chinese as a Second Language students to learn vocabulary and sentence patterns independently

AbstractThe important roles and great challenges of second language (L2) vocabulary learning have long been the concern of L2 teaching and learning. This invited workshop introduced a self-developed e-learning platform, “mLang”, a seamless language learning platform and pedagogy to empower the students to become active learners in expanding their CSL vocabulary. With thoughtful pedagogical designs, teachers can support students to use multilingual and multimodal means to contribute “mLang cards” as shared learning objects to become part of their curriculum content, which reflect the students’ own experiences and perspectives of the world and what they feel interested to learn and share. Through the learners’ interaction around the “mLang cards” and the re-use of them for further learning, the learners can have more opportunities of feeling themselves being competent, autonomous and socially related in their CSL learning, and develop their self-determined motivation (Deci & Ryan 1985). Research findings indicated that this method can multiply and energize L2 learners’ Chinese vocabulary learning, and help their quicker transition to reading and writing. It is believed that this method is not only relevant to CSL, but also to the learning of minority students in different L2 societies.
